Lake Cavanaugh experiences four distinct seasons with an average annual temperature of 49°F (9°C). Winters average 38°F in January while summers reach 63°F in July. The area gets 233 sunny days per year. Annual precipitation totals 49.0 inches. The area receives 4.3 inches of snow annually. Air quality is rated Good with a median AQI of 28.

Lake Cavanaugh has a seasonal temperature swing of 25°F / from 38°F in December to 63°F in August. Total annual precipitation is 54.7 inches, with November being the wettest month (7.8") and July the driest (1.7").
